Coffee Campana

, 2011

Musée D'Orsay - Paris, France

The coffee Campana, located at the exit of the Impressionist Gallery, is a place that sparks the imagination. Designed by the brothers Campana, Brazilian designers, who wanted to create a dreamlike aquatic atmosphere inspired by Emile Gallé and his drawings of marine animals. The result is a strange profusion of orange metal structures, golden chandeliers, metal walls and pebble-shaped chairs.

The interior design of the café is based on the large clock that decorates the external wall and offers an impressive view of the right bank of the Seine, from the Louvre to the Tuileries.
